HIP 88943

HIP 88943 is a B-type (Blue-White) star located in the constellation Sagittarius.

At a distance of roughly 1,496 light-years, HIP 88943 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 88943 is classified as a spectral class B star (B-type (Blue-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 88943 has an apparent magnitude of +7.32,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its blue-white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.079.
